Our difference: Peer support 

WomenCAN Australia is immensely proud of its unique peer support initiative,

​

The Placement Circle, which is based on more than 40 years of research. 

​

The Placement Circle is women striding the path to financial independence side by side.

Need a 

Tradeswoman?

WomenCAN Australia does even more than provide free training and education and guaranteed jobs. We run own social enterprise of dozens of talented tradeswomen.  

​

Dozens of tradeswomen, cleaners, and gardeners deliver services by women for women in their homes.
